East Coast Girls
East Coast Girls | Kerry Kletter
5 posts | 5 read | 5 to read
They share countless perfect memories--and one they wish they could forget. Childhood friends Hannah, Maya, Blue and Renee share a bond that feels more like family. Growing up, they had difficult home lives, and the summers they spent vacationing together in Montauk were the happiest memories they ever made--campfires on the beach, salt-spray hair and the effervescent excitement of the bright future ahead. Then, the summer after graduation, one terrible night changed everything. Twelve years have passed since that fateful incident, and during that time, their sisterhood has drifted apart, each woman haunted by her own lost innocence. But just as they reunite in Montauk for one last summer together, hoping to heal those wounds and find happiness once more, tragedy strikes again. This time it'll test them like never before, forcing them to confront decisions they've each had to live with and old secrets that refuse to stay buried. Told with lyrical prose and sharp insights into human nature, East Coast Girls unveils the dark truths that can threaten even the deepest friendships and the unconditional love that makes them stronger than ever.

This is hard. Is it a beach read? Check. Did I think of a time when I would devour books about friendships in one day? Also check. But even as a simple summer novel, it dealt with weighty material in a less weighty way. If it had been pure escapism, it might lack depth. Darker, it would be a different novel. I enjoyed it, but couldn‘t help but wonder how some things could have been different, sort of like the subject matter in the novel itself.
